**Mgmt Meeting Minutes — Retiring the Brightline Range**

Quick recap for sales leads at Fenholt Supplies: we agreed to retire the Brightline fixture range by year-end. Remaining stock moves to clearance pricing next month, and accounts on standing orders get migrated to the Lumetta range. Trade-in incentives were approved in principle. The confidential note on next steps sits just below.

board note of bajof-bajeg: The pricing group signed off on a budget of $13.4 million for Project Sildor. The renewal with Lamixek Holdings closes at $48.9 million a year, 49 percent above the last contract.

Quick one today, folks. We agreed to push everyone onto annual billing for the Lanterfeld suite starting next quarter. Monthly stays only for legacy Pemwick accounts, and even those get a nudge at renewal. Marnie's team will draft the customer comms; finance handles proration quirks. Expect some grumbling from the smaller shops — hold the line, discounts capped at 8%. Incentive details for leads get sorted next week. The confidential planning note sits just below these minutes.

board note of kageg-bahof: The renewal with Holwynax Holdings closes at $2 million a year, 5 percent below the last contract. Project Ulaath slips by two quarters because of the supplier delay.

/*
 * Fixture: large-file diff rendering (Splitpane viewer).
 * Generates a 40MB synthetic diff pair to exercise chunked
 * rendering and the virtual scroll path. Do not shrink the
 * payload — smaller files skip the chunking code entirely.
 * The fixture fetches baseline blobs from the Tarnwell
 * staging store, which requires auth on every request.
 * Contractors: never point this at prod; the staging host
 * is the only permitted target. Requests must include the
 * bearer token below.
 */

session JWT of yawep-yawep = eyJhbGciOiJIUzI1NiIsInR5cCI6IkpXVCJ9.eyJzdWIiOiI3pWF3_In0.aXYsHiog

## Account Recovery — Trailnote Offline Mode

When a surveyor's Trailnote app has been offline for 30+ days, their local credentials expire and sync refuses to resume. Don't make them wipe the device — all their unsynced field data lives there! Instead, open the support console, pick "Offline Reinstate," and enter their handle. The console will ask for the support team's shared recovery passphrase before issuing a reinstatement token. Use the one below.

unlock words, bagaf-fajeg: zorael-kelax-fraath-quenix-eliok-sileth-aldmir-wenir-druiel